Transaction 2b6660fef973c90b52c066648712fff86c577eef14bd34069deaf7e132018f37
1 Input
1 Output
-
2b6660fef973c90b52c066648712fff86c577eef14bd34069deaf7e132018f37:0
- value
- 93248
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e84462fc1245f7dce61ed3329426357d3fb5d03 OP_EQUAL
- address
- 38rB65QKTpLfjS7dZc36MVB3VhDRK68Zpg